Semi-classical Scar functions in phase space
We develop a semi-classical approximation for the scar function in the Weyl-Wigner representation in the neighborhood of a classically unstable periodic orbit of chaotic two dimensional systems. The prediction of hyperbolic fringes, asymptotic to the stable and unstable manifolds, is verified computationally for a (linear) cat map, after the theory is adapted to a discrete phase space appropria...

متن کاملUniversal Approximator Property of the Space of Hyperbolic Tangent Functions
In this paper, first the space of hyperbolic tangent functions is introduced and then the universal approximator property of this space is proved. In fact, by using this space, any nonlinear continuous function can be uniformly approximated with any degree of accuracy. Also, as an application, this space of functions is utilized to design feedback control for a nonlinear dynamical system.
